3种梅毒血清学诊断试验的临床应用评价

摘    要:目的通过比较3种梅毒血清学检测方法的敏感性、特异性,选择简单、快速、敏感性高和特异性强的检测方法。提高对梅毒(特别是妊娠期隐性梅毒)的早期诊治,控制梅毒传播。方法采用甲苯胺红不加热血清反应素试验(TRUST),梅毒螺旋体特异性抗体明胶凝集试验(TPPA),梅毒螺旋体抗体诊断试剂盒(胶体金法)3种方法检测218例血清标本,TPPA法和胶体金法检测40例质控标本。结果TRUST、TPPA、胶体金法对95例梅毒血清标本和123例非梅毒血清标本对照组的敏感性分别为78.9%、97.9%、88.4%,特异性分别为84.6%、98.4%、96.7%。TPPA法的敏感性明显高于TRusT法和胶体金法,差异有统计学意义(P〈0.05);胶体金法对2NCU梅毒确认抗体室内质控和低浓度室间质评标本均不能检出,其敏感性明显低于TPPA法,差异有统计学意义(P〈0.05);TPPA法的特异性明显高于TRUST法,差异有统计学意义(P〈O.05),TPPA法特异性高于胶体金法,差异有统计学意义(P〈0.05)。结论TPPA法有极高的敏感性和特异性,可作为梅毒血清抗体检测的确证方法;胶体金法简便快速,较适用于临床急诊标本检测;TRUST法适用于梅毒疗程观察和疗效判断,有助于判断梅毒复发及再感染,采用TPPA和TRUST联合检测,既可提高梅毒检出的阳性率,减少漏诊和误诊;又可作为病程观察和疗效判断的指标,以便梅毒患者能得出及时有效的诊治,对有效控制妊娠期梅毒和胎传梅毒的发生及梅毒传播都具有较大的临床价值。

Clinical evaluation and treatment optimization for three different syphilis serum diagnostic methods

Abstract:Objective To improve the accuracy for diagnosing syphilis in early stage and to optimize clinical existing methods by comparing three different syphilis serum diagnostic methods in the directions of sensitivity and specificity.Methods We tested 218 different patient specimens with Toluidine Red Unheated Serum Test(TRUST),Treponema Pallidum Particle Agglutination(TPPA)and Diagnostic Kit for Antibody to Treponema Pallidum(Colloidal Gold)respectively.The other 40 quality control specimens were examined by usin...
